About Irish Terrier
Medium, athletic terrier with a wiry red coat, low shedding when properly groomed. Intelligent, energetic, and independent, needing daily exercise and mental stimulation. Deeply loyal and people‑oriented, a keen watchdog, with strong prey drive and sometimes challenging with other dogs.
About Italian Greyhound
The Italian Greyhound is a tiny, fine‑boned sighthound with a short, low‑shedding coat and elegant movement. Affectionate, sensitive and people‑oriented, it bonds closely, needs warmth, gentle training, moderate exercise with safe sprints, and careful handling to protect its delicate limbs.
